1

The Capital Traffic Camera Locations

News Discuss 
Are you driving around Ottawa and needing to know where the traffic cameras are located? Well, look no further! This overview will point you to all the key areas where traffic enforcement is in effect. Cameras can be https://fraseracye531391.isblog.net/ottawa-traffic-camera-locations-51460548

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story